RE: Seats on the above web site (e-bay)... These look like nice panther leather seats at a fair price and would be good for someone to swap out for "leatherette". But they're not English panther leather. EPLs have the really nice quality soft leather, parallel stitching, and white contrasting piping.

I've been the routes all have mentioned above. "Oh, you should've called us last week because we had a set of those..." is a common conversation I've had. I've also gone through the parts companies that "search the country" for you- one even claiming they had a set in stock. When asked to send a photo they didn't without explanation, without a return call and kept my search fee. I've talked to the folks at Katzkin and was told they do not replicate the EPLs- it's more than just a recover job unfortunately. Custom made seats are expensive and do not have the airbags (but neither do aftermarket seats for the most part). I have not dealt with LKQ and will follow that lead- thanks for the tip.
